How difficult Is internal transfer within salesforce? How was your experience for the same? Did your current managers cause issues ?
You need to interview for internal transfer. About 3 vs 6 for external candidates. However bar for interviews is same.
Also current manager does not have know till you clear a interview
How about pay hike?? Do you get any increment when you move to a new team?
Good.. keep moving via OOM. It works great
I transferred. Had a great experience. The company encourages transfer for growth as long as you’ve been in role for a year. No comp change. You can only transfer at same level.
